评分
评分
评分
评分
老实说,在翻开《Teradata SQL》之前,我对Teradata这个数据库系统只有一些模糊的概念。我知道它很强大,很适合处理海量数据,但具体怎么用,怎么写SQL才能发挥它的优势,我一直缺乏一个系统性的认识。这本书,就像一把钥匙,为我打开了通往Teradata SQL世界的大门。让我印象最深刻的是,作者在书中并没有止步于讲解SQL的语法,而是深入到Teradata的内部机制,比如它的并行处理能力、它的查询优化机制等等。这对于我这种想要深入理解数据库底层原理的读者来说,简直是如饥似渴。书中关于并行查询(Parallel Query Execution)的章节,我反复看了好几遍。作者用非常形象的比喻,将Teradata如何将一个复杂的查询拆解成多个子查询,然后在不同的AMP(Access Module Processor)上并行执行的过程描绘得淋漓尽致。这让我彻底理解了为什么Teradata在处理大数据时能够如此高效。而且,书中还给出了如何通过SQL语句的设计来最大化地利用这种并行能力,比如如何合理地使用JOIN、如何避免不必要的排序等等。我特别欣赏的是,作者在讲解每一个概念时,都会配以大量的实际操作演示和代码示例。这些示例都非常贴近实际业务场景,让我能够一边阅读,一边动手实践,从而加深理解。我甚至觉得,这本书不仅仅是教我怎么写SQL,更是教我怎么“思考”Teradata SQL。它让我从一个“使用者”转变为一个“理解者”,一个能够主动去利用Teradata的特性来解决问题的“优化者”。
评分说实话,我拿到《Teradata SQL》这本书的时候,并没有抱有太高的期望值。毕竟,数据库方面的书籍,很多都流于表面,讲讲SQL语法,然后就没了。但这本书,真的让我眼前一亮,甚至可以说是惊喜。它最让我印象深刻的地方,在于它对Teradata SQL特性的深入剖析。你知道,很多时候,我们接触到的SQL教程,都是围绕着MySQL、PostgreSQL这些常见的数据库来的,而Teradata,由于其独特的架构和市场定位,有着自己的独到之处。这本书却恰恰抓住了这一点,它并没有回避Teradata SQL与标准SQL之间的差异,反而将这些差异点放大,并给出了详尽的解释。比如,书中关于分区(Partitioning)和分桶(Bucketing)的论述,简直就是点睛之笔。我之前一直对这两个概念有些模糊,虽然知道它们对性能至关重要,但具体如何设计、如何影响查询效率,却一直没找到一个清晰的脉络。这本书通过生动的图示和实际案例,将这两个概念讲得明明白白,甚至连不同分区策略和分桶策略的优缺点都进行了详细的对比分析,让我瞬间茅塞顿开。此外,书中对于Teradata的优化器(Optimizer)的讲解,也是我非常看重的一部分。优化器是数据库的“大脑”,理解它的工作原理,对于编写高效的SQL至关重要。这本书没有泛泛而谈,而是深入到优化器的决策过程,以及如何通过SQL语句的编写方式来影响它的决策,这对于我优化现有查询、编写高性能SQL起到了决定性的作用。读这本书,就像是在和一位经验丰富的Teradata架构师进行一对一的交流,他的知识储备和实践经验,通过文字传递给我,让我少走了很多弯路。
评分在阅读《Teradata SQL》的过程中,我最大的感受是,作者的经验非常丰富,并且非常愿意分享。他并没有把书写得像是一篇冷冰冰的教科书,而是充满了个人色彩和实战经验。我特别喜欢书中关于“数据建模”和“索引设计”的章节。在Teradata环境中,合理的数据建模和索引设计,对于查询性能至关重要。作者在这方面给出了非常详细的指导,包括如何根据业务需求来选择不同的建模方法,如何设计高效的索引,以及如何评估索引的效果。他甚至还讲解了Teradata的一些特殊索引类型,比如“二级索引”(Secondary Indexes)和“多维聚类索引”(Multi-Dimensional Clustering,MDC)。这让我对Teradata的索引机制有了全新的认识。我记得书中有一个案例,是关于如何通过调整表的分布键(Distribution Key)来解决数据倾斜问题。作者不仅给出了具体的SQL语句,还详细解释了为什么这样调整能够有效解决问题。这让我觉得,这本书不仅仅是在教我SQL,更是在教我如何成为一个优秀的Teradata数据库开发者。它让我从一个“SQL使用者”变成了一个“Teradata优化专家”。这本书的语言风格非常平实,却又不失深度,让我能够轻松地吸收其中的知识。
评分这本书,哦,《Teradata SQL》,我真的必须得说说。初拿到手的时候,就被它厚重的质感吸引了,你知道那种沉甸甸的,翻开每一页都感觉在吸收知识的书页的触感吗?我一直深耕数据领域,但说实话,Teradata SQL这个部分,总感觉像是一个我一直想去探险的未知领域。市面上关于SQL的书不少,但针对Teradata这种庞大的、企业级数据库的,能写到位的真心不多。我抱着既期待又有点忐忑的心情翻开了第一页,想看看它到底能带我走到多深。刚开始确实有点吃力,毕竟Teradata的架构和标准SQL有一些微妙却重要的区别,这些细节如果不深入挖掘,很容易就被忽略。但作者在早期章节里,对这些底层逻辑的梳理,以及对Teradata SQL方言的介绍,给我留下了深刻的印象。他没有上来就抛出一堆复杂的查询语句,而是循序渐进,从基础概念入手,然后逐步引导读者理解Teradata SQL在实际应用中的威力。我特别欣赏的是,书里并没有仅仅停留在理论层面,而是穿插了大量的实际案例,这些案例的设定非常贴近我日常工作中可能会遇到的场景,比如如何高效地处理海量数据、如何优化复杂的报表查询、如何在不同业务需求之间找到平衡点等等。而且,它不仅仅是告诉你“怎么做”,更重要的是告诉你“为什么这么做”,这种刨根问底的精神,让我受益匪浅。比如,书中对于某些特定函数的解释,不仅给出了语法,还详细分析了其执行原理,以及在什么情况下使用最能发挥效率,这对于一个追求极致性能的数据库开发者来说,简直是宝藏。我甚至觉得,这本书不仅是一本技术手册,更像是一位经验丰富的老前辈在分享他多年的实战心得,那种实在、不藏私的感觉,在如今这个信息碎片化的时代,尤为珍贵。我还会继续深入研读,因为我知道,这只是一个开始,Teradata SQL的世界还有很多等待我去发掘。
评分坦白说,我对Teradata SQL的学习过程,一直以来都充满了挑战,直到我遇到了《Teradata SQL》这本书。它以一种非常独特的方式,将复杂的Teradata SQL概念,变得易于理解和掌握。作者的写作风格非常引人入胜,他并没有像其他技术书籍那样,一味地罗列枯燥的语法和命令,而是通过生动的语言和丰富的案例,将Teradata SQL的魅力展现得淋漓尽致。我特别喜欢书中关于“用户自定义函数”(User-Defined Functions,UDFs)的讲解。我之前一直觉得UDFs是一个比较高级的功能,自己没有能力去掌握。但这本书,通过详细的步骤和示例,让我一步步地学会了如何创建和使用UDFs,并且认识到了UDFs在Teradata SQL中的强大作用。例如,书中有一个案例,是如何利用UDFs来实现一些复杂的业务逻辑,从而简化SQL语句,提高代码的可读性。这让我觉得,这本书不仅仅是在教我SQL,更是在激发我的创造力,让我能够利用Teradata SQL来解决更复杂、更有挑战性的问题。总而言之,这本书为我提供了一个非常全面、深入且实用的Teradata SQL学习平台,我从中获益良多,并且强烈推荐给所有对Teradata SQL感兴趣的读者。
评分我必须得说,《Teradata SQL》这本书,给我带来了前所未有的学习体验。它不仅仅是一本技术书籍,更像是一次与作者心灵的对话。作者的语言风格非常生动幽默,他能够将那些看似枯燥的技术概念,用一种轻松易懂的方式表达出来。我非常欣赏他在书中对于Teradata SQL中一些“坑”的提示,这些“坑”往往是很多初学者容易忽略的,但却会对查询性能产生巨大的影响。比如,书中对于“数据倾斜”(Data Skew)的讲解,就非常到位。作者不仅解释了数据倾斜产生的原因,还提供了多种检测和解决数据倾斜的方法,并且给出了具体的SQL示例。这让我彻底摆脱了之前面对数据倾斜时的无助感。我尤其喜欢书中关于“SQL调优”的部分。作者并没有给出一些通用的调优技巧,而是深入到Teradata的查询执行过程,分析了在不同情况下,SQL语句是如何被执行的,以及如何通过调整SQL语句来优化执行计划。他甚至还介绍了如何利用Teradata的系统表来查看查询的执行计划,并根据执行计划中的信息来定位性能瓶颈。这让我觉得,这本书不仅仅是在教我写SQL,更是在教我如何成为一个“SQL侦探”,去发现和解决SQL中的问题。我甚至觉得,这本书的价值,远超乎其定价。它让我对Teradata SQL的理解,从“知其然”上升到了“知其所以然”。
评分我一直认为,掌握一门数据库的SQL语言,关键在于理解它的“灵魂”,而不仅仅是“语法”。《Teradata SQL》这本书,恰恰做到了这一点。它并没有仅仅罗列SQL的各种命令和函数,而是通过一种非常有条理的方式,将Teradata SQL的核心理念,深入浅出地呈现在读者面前。让我感到欣慰的是,书中对Teradata SQL中的一些高级特性,比如分析函数(Analytic Functions)和窗口函数(Window Functions)的讲解,非常细致。我之前在处理一些复杂的数据分析问题时,经常会遇到需要写一些非常冗长和低效的SQL,现在通过学习这本书,我发现这些问题都可以通过巧妙地运用这些函数来优雅地解决。作者在讲解这些函数时,不仅仅给出了语法,还详细阐述了它们的应用场景,以及如何根据不同的业务需求进行定制。我印象特别深刻的是,书中关于“CTE”(Common Table Expressions,公共表表达式)的讲解。我之前对CTE的理解仅停留在“让SQL看起来更整洁”,但这本书让我认识到,CTE在Teradata中不仅仅是语法糖,它还能在一定程度上影响查询的执行计划,从而提高性能。作者通过对比使用CTE和不使用CTE的查询执行计划,直观地展示了其优势。这让我受益匪浅,也让我对CTE有了更深层次的理解。这本书的结构设计也非常合理,从基础的查询语句到复杂的数据处理,再到性能优化,层层递进,让读者能够循序渐进地掌握Teradata SQL的精髓。
评分这本书,《Teradata SQL》,当我开始阅读时,我发现它不仅仅是一本枯燥的技术手册,而更像是一次精心设计的探索之旅。作者的笔触非常细腻,他并没有一开始就用那些令人生畏的专业术语轰炸读者,而是从一个非常基础的视角出发,循循善诱。我特别喜欢书中关于数据仓库概念的引入,以及Teradata在其中扮演的关键角色。这种宏观的视角,让我能够更好地理解SQL在实际业务场景中的意义,而不仅仅是把它当成一种工具。书中对Teradata SQL语法的讲解,可以说是非常到位。他不仅列出了各种语句的语法结构,更重要的是,他深入分析了每条语句背后的逻辑,以及它在Teradata环境下的执行效率。例如,对于JOIN操作的讲解,书中不仅区分了不同的JOIN类型,还详细阐述了Teradata如何处理这些JOIN,以及如何根据实际数据量和表结构选择最优的JOIN策略。我尤其赞赏的是,书中穿插的许多“陷阱”和“误区”的提示,这些都是作者在实际工作中踩过的坑,现在他用书本的形式分享出来,让我们这些后来者能够避免重蹈覆辙。这种“避坑指南”式的写法,对我来说价值连城。我记得书中有一个章节,专门讲解了如何写出“可读性高”且“性能好”的SQL。这不仅仅是关于代码的格式,更是关于逻辑的清晰、变量的命名,以及注释的使用。这让我意识到,SQL的编写,不仅仅是技术活,更是一门艺术。当我读到关于Teradata的函数库时,我更是惊叹于其丰富性和实用性。书中对一些常用且强大的函数进行了详细的介绍,并且提供了丰富的示例,让我能够立刻将所学应用到实践中。
评分我曾经花了大量的时间去研究Teradata SQL,但总觉得不得要领,无法真正地发挥出它的潜力。《Teradata SQL》这本书,就像一位经验丰富的向导,带领我走过了一条清晰的学习路径。它最让我印象深刻的是,作者对Teradata SQL的“性能调优”部分,进行了非常深入的讲解。他并没有泛泛而谈,而是从SQL语句的执行计划入手,详细分析了各种常见的性能瓶颈,以及相应的解决方案。例如,书中对于“全表扫描”(Full Table Scan)的讲解,就非常到位。作者解释了为什么会发生全表扫描,以及如何通过优化SQL语句、创建合适的索引等方式来避免全表扫描,从而提高查询效率。他还介绍了Teradata提供的各种工具,比如“Explain Plan”工具,来帮助我们分析查询的执行计划。这让我觉得,这本书不仅仅是一本技术手册,更像是一本“SQL性能调优的葵花宝典”。我甚至觉得,这本书的作者一定是一位在Teradata领域有着多年实践经验的资深专家,他的知识和经验,通过这本书传递给了我们。它让我对Teradata SQL的理解,从“知其然”上升到了“知其所以然”,让我能够更自信、更高效地运用Teradata SQL来解决实际问题。
评分拿到《Teradata SQL》这本书时,我正面临着一项棘手的项目,需要处理海量的历史数据,并且需要生成非常复杂的报表。市面上关于SQL的书籍很多,但很少有能够针对Teradata这种高性能、大数据处理的数据库进行如此深入的讲解。这本书,就像及时雨一样,出现在我的面前。它最吸引我的地方在于,作者并没有回避Teradata SQL的复杂性,而是迎难而上,将那些看似晦涩难懂的概念,解释得清晰明了。我特别喜欢书中关于“临时表”(Temporary Tables)和“表函数”(Table Functions)的讲解。我之前在使用这些功能时,总感觉有些摸不着头脑,不知道什么时候该用,什么时候不该用,以及如何使用才能发挥最大效果。这本书通过大量的实际案例,将这些概念的应用场景和最佳实践,展现得淋漓尽致。例如,书中有一个案例,是如何利用临时表来缓存中间结果,从而避免重复计算,极大地提高了报表生成的速度。这让我茅塞顿开,也让我对Teradata SQL的运用有了新的认识。此外,书中对于“SQL注入”等安全方面的讨论,虽然不是重点,但也体现了作者的全面性和细致。它让我意识到,在编写SQL时,不仅要考虑性能,还要考虑安全性。这本书的价值,在于它不仅仅教你“怎么写”,更教你“为什么这么写”,让你能够真正地理解Teradata SQL的精髓,并将其运用到实际工作中。
评分连这个都有啊>< 民工专用。
评分连这个都有啊>< 民工专用。
评分基本上每年都会有略微的更新吧 对ANSI进行了扩展,并且融入了自己的东西。不错
评分基本上每年都会有略微的更新吧 对ANSI进行了扩展,并且融入了自己的东西。不错
评分基本上每年都会有略微的更新吧 对ANSI进行了扩展,并且融入了自己的东西。不错
本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度,google,bing,sogou 等
© 2026 qciss.net All Rights Reserved. 小哈图书下载中心 版权所有